shrimp scampi.

this is very easy to make and takes about a half hour with proper preparation.

ingredients:

one 16 oz box of your favorite fettuccine. i like barilla pasta.
4 tablespoons of butter
2 tablespoons of olive oil or vegetable oil
4 to 8 garlic cloves. i like 8 because i live life dangerously :4
1 to 2 pounds of deveined uncooked shrimp. med or large
1/2 cup of chopped fresh parsley
4 teaspoons of graded lemon peel
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
2/3 cup of dry white wine. chicken broth can be substitute


start with cooking fettuccine to desired tenderness.
while cooking fettuccine, melt butter with oil in a large saucepan over med heat.
add garlic; cook and stir 1 minute.
add shrimp; cook and stir 1 minute.
add the rest of ingredients and cook for 1 to 2 minutes or until shrimp turns pink.

drain fettuccine
pour shrimp mixture over pasta and toss/stir well.
i like to use the leftover lemon and squeeze the juice all over the mixture while stirring.

mom's recipe sloppy joes:

1 lb hamburger
1 cup ketchup
1 tbsp mustard

Brown hamburger, drain grease, dump 1 cup ketchup on top, mix in 1 tbsp mustard (or to taste), throw that ---- on some buns...best sloppy joes ever

fried elvis.

1 banana
2 slices of bread
peanut butter
butter/margerine
brown sugar
skillet
turner/flipper of your choice


butter bread slices on one side. set aside for now

make a carmel from some of the butter/marg by first melting 2-3tablespoons, and brown sugar(3-4tablespoons or so). cook bananas in it until golden brown and soft

------ peanut butter on one slice of bread, put banana carmel mixture into the other slide, butter side down. put peanutbutter slice on top, grill like a grilled cheese.

enjoy!
